Python和MATLAB读取excel指定行列数据的方法

Python021

Python和MATLAB读取excel指定行列数据的方法,第1张

1、用xlrd读取 对应方法如下,需要先import xlrd和numpy,通过row_start和row_end控制行数,通过column_start和column_end控制列数 这里要注意python是0-based索引,excel看的时候是1-based的索引 2、用pandas下的read_excel函数 dframe = pd.read_excel(“file_name.xlsx”) dframe = pd.read_excel(“file_name.xlsx”, sheetname=”Sheet_name”) dframe = pd.read_excel(“file_name.xlsx”, sheetname=number) 读取表格的方式有两种: 1、xlsread [~,MeaDef,~]=xlsread(xls_site,table_tag,'B12:AI12') 这里输出是一个对应数字,一个对应字符串,一个是用元胞把所有数据放在一起 对应的xlswrite格式:xlswrite(xls_site_output,train,1,['A',num2str(ix+1),':M',num2str(ix+1)]) 2、read_table

用python读取excel中的一列数据步骤如下:

1、首先打开dos命令窗,安装必须的两个库,命令是:pip3 install xlrd;Pip3 install xlwt。

2、准备好excel。

3、打开pycharm,新建一个excel.py的文件,首先导入支持库import xlrdimport xlwt。

4、要操作excel,首先得打开excel,使用open_workbook(‘路径’),要获取行与列,使用nrows(行),ncols(列),获取具体的值,使用cell(row,col).value。

5、要在excel里写入值,就要使用write属性,重点说明写入是用到xlwt这个支援库,思路是先新建excel,然后新建页签B,然后将一组数据写入到B,最后保存为excel.xls。

1、选中整个表格。右键-“表格属性”

2、在表格属性对话框,选择“行”选项卡,勾选“指定高度”,调整满意的高度值,行高值是“固定值”。

3、然后选择“列”选项卡,勾选“指定列宽”,调整列宽为满意值。

4、确定即可。